The best time to fly from Colombo to Jakarta Soekarno-Hatta International Airport (CGK)

  • It's time to figure out your travel dates for your flight from Colombo to Jakarta Soekarno-Hatta International Airport (CGK). December is the busiest month to visit Jakarta. If you like your getaways a little more chill, think about going in September.

  • Before locking in your Colombo to CGK plane ticket, consider the kind of weather forecast you're hoping for. October is the warmest month in Jakarta, with temperatures ranging from 25ºC (77ºF) to 32ºC (90ºF).

  • Look for cheap tickets from Colombo to Jakarta Soekarno-Hatta International Airport in July if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 24ºC (75ºF) and 31ºC (88ºF).

Explore more of Indonesia

  • Bandung is just one of the many cities in Indonesia waiting to be explored once you've taken in the sights of Jakarta. Around 137 kilometres away to the southeast, its top attractions include Gedung Merdeka, Jalan Asia Afrika and KidCity Trans Studio Mall Bandung.

  • If you're eager to discover another side of Indonesia, consider Bandar Lampung, roughly 177 kilometres northwest of Jakarta. Way Kambas National Park, Pantai Srengsem KAI and Krakatau Monument are key highlights.
